Location: Brighton UK
Type: Full-time | Permanent
About Us
Anything is Possible is an independent integrated Media, Creative and Technology agency headquartered in Brighton. The agency works with ambitious brands to deliver transformative marketing solutions powered by data, creativity and technology.
Our team combines strategy, analytics, creative thinking and media expertise to drive measurable growth for clients across digital and traditional channels.
We’re looking for a newly qualified finance graduate to join our growing finance team — someone eager to start their career, learn quickly and help us build smarter financial processes as we scale.
The Role
This is an entry-level opportunity designed for a recent finance, accounting or business graduate looking to start their first role in industry.
Working alongside the Finance Manager and wider operations team, you will help support the day-to-day financial operations of the agency while gaining exposure to budgeting, reporting and commercial finance within a fast-growing marketing business.
Key Responsibilities
- Assist with day-to-day finance operations including invoices, purchase orders and expense processing.
- Support accounts payable and receivable processes.
- Process and reconcile accounts payable and receivable.
- Support UK payments as processes transition.
- Support month-end close processes, including bank reconciliations.
- Process and reconcile supplier invoices and statements.
- Assist with cash monitoring.
- Maintain and improve financial spreadsheets.
- Support finance team with month-end processes.
- Contribute to improving financial systems and processes as the business grows.
- Help the team with accounts reconciliation.
- Communicate with the wider team about the media plans.
What We’re Looking For
Essential
- Recent graduate in Finance, Accounting, Economics, Business or related field.
- Looking for their first full-time role in finance.
- Strong numerical and analytical skills.
- Good Excel / spreadsheet skills.
- Strong attention to detail.
- Excellent organisation and time management.
- A proactive mindset and willingness to learn.
Desirable
- Internship, placement year or part-time experience in finance.
- Familiarity with accounting software (e.g. Xero, Sage, NetSuite).
- Interest in working in media, marketing or creative industries.
What You’ll Gain
- Structured on-the-job learning in a commercial finance environment.
- Exposure to agency financial operations and client revenue models.
- Mentoring from experienced finance leaders.
- Opportunity to pursue professional finance qualifications (ACCA / CIMA / ACA support where applicable).
- Work within a collaborative, fast-growing agency environment.
